Don't let spring cleaning get in the way of your allergies--in fact, make sure your "big clean" isn't simultaneously stirring up dust mites and pollen that will only make things worse for your allergies. Take a look at this article on for advice on minimizing allergens.

Some tips include using dry clean techniques only for carpets and other upholstery, since unnecessary damp spots in your home promote mold and mildew growth. Wash all drapes where you have them, and check out the rest of the website for other allergy-friendly products.
